About Edward Kim, MD
I focus on diagnosing and treating spine disorders and sports injuries. With my advanced training in physical medicine and rehabilitation and my patient-centered approach, I provide personalized care and effective results. I chose a career in medicine to help address physical ailments and the profound impact they can have on a persons overall quality of life.Philosophy of care
My patient care approach is centered on empathy, collaboration and comprehensive care. I use evidence-based practices and aim for detailed assessments and treatment plans geared to each patient. My philosophy includes a holistic view of overall well-being.Gender
